Output 047421de87895a26ad81199a562d591dd120d1b6ee2e2c67e737792362728f17:2

value
312416
script pubkey
OP_0 OP_PUSHBYTES_20 68c09bccd4746eac0567ee425fe20becb6eabfa2
address
bc1qdrqfhnx5w3h2cpt8aep9lcstajmw40az0gu7qx
transaction
047421de87895a26ad81199a562d591dd120d1b6ee2e2c67e737792362728f17
spent
true